Catawba College’s Department of Music is offering private music instruction in brass instruments, woodwinds, and piano to students of all ages this summer.

Dr. Steve Etters is the instructor for brass instruments, including trumpet, trombone, baritone and tuba.  Maria Stine will provide private instruction in woodwinds, including clarinet, saxophone, double reed instruments and (beginner only) flute. Susan McClain is the instructor for piano students at all levels.

Tuition is $15 per 30-minute lesson, with a $15 registration fee required to confirm enrollment.  Lesson days and times vary with individual instructors and students may enroll for varied number of lessons.
